Transaction 0663c97fcf3593c573bf3cca3d7bebd87283a6d74e147930b911a6e79319df76
1 Input
1 Output
-
0663c97fcf3593c573bf3cca3d7bebd87283a6d74e147930b911a6e79319df76:0
- value
- 664754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fa10f8551e553cacfa6fa4c83d5daa603b2065f OP_EQUAL
- address
- 3BsFsXSDQdQmwEUbKZGSHCCxrdDdyMGFPW